Saga was one of the first instrument manufacturers to offer an
all-solid spruce, East Indian rosewood back and sided dreadnaught
guitar to the market for under $1000! That was the ever popular BR-160.
Setting even higher standards of quality, value and innovation by
adding to those same great features a solid Adirondack spruce top, and
you get one great guitar...the BR-160A! It really packs that Pre-War
Punch at a price anyone can afford!
- Select and rare, solid Adirondack spruce top with hand-carved parabolic top braces in authentic prewar forward X-pattern
- Solid, Select Indian rosewood back and sides with center strip of delicate wood marquetry
- White body binding with delicate herringbone inlay around top
- Slim mahogany neck with dovetail neck joint and adjustable truss rod
- Rosewood bridge and bridge plate
- Rosewood peghead overlay adorned with a unique Mother-of-pearl and abalone design
- Saga's exclusive Dalmation-style pickguard
- High-gloss lightly toned top finish
- Accurate vintage-style 14:1 ratio nickel-plated open-back tuners with butterbean-style buttons
- Nut and saddle are made from bone
- Nut width: 1 11/16"
- Scale length: 25.5"
